Another fine “Estate Firearm” offered for sale by DenKirk Arms – This Winchester Model 1885 High Wall single action rifle in 45-70 caliber, manufactured in 1910, was custom restored by Bob Gilman of Gilman / Mayfield of Fresno, California in the mid-late 1980’s, with special order features like a Satin Plus blued high gloss finish and an Exhibition Grade wood stock & fore end, finishing the stock with an original crescent butt plate.
Barrel - The 1 1/8” diameter tapered octagon barrel was turned to round starting at 12” from the receiver, producing a 1/3 octagon & 2/3 round barrel down to 13/16” diameter at the end of the muzzle, which was then finished with a concave muzzle. The bore is bright with strong rifling and the action is in excellent mechanical condition.
Sights - The front sight is a Lyman Series 17A hooded sight with an insert. The barrel rear sight is an original Winchester Model 1892 flip-up ladder sight, in original condition. The rear tang sight is a flip-up David Pedersoli Track Of The Wolf mid-range peep sight.
